The Rise to Fame: Early Career and Disney Days
Alright, let's rewind to the beginning. Before the chart-topping hits and the candid interviews, there was a young girl with a big dream: Demi Lovato. Her journey began like many young stars, with roles in Disney Channel productions. This initial exposure was a huge stepping stone, and a significant part of what makes up the good. Seriously, Disney provided a launchpad, offering her incredible opportunities and giving her a platform to showcase her talents. From shows like Camp Rock (remember Mitchie?!), where her voice first stunned the world, to other Disney projects, she quickly became a household name. These roles were pivotal in shaping her early career, and giving her vital experience that she would go on to use. It helped build a solid fanbase, allowing her to connect with millions of people. Her first solo album, Don't Forget, was released in 2008, just as she was becoming a household name. And, wow, it was a hit! The album was a mix of pop and rock, and it showed off her vocal prowess. This album was a strong introduction, showing the world that she was here to stay. This launched her fully into the mainstream music scene, and gave her a very strong image. Seriously, this era of her career was iconic. It cemented her status as a singer and songwriter, and it gave her fans something that they could really love. This was a critical step in her career, solidifying her status as a serious musical artist. From the very beginning, Demi Lovato established herself as a force to be reckoned with. The Hits and the Heartbreak: Chart-Topping Success and Personal Struggles
Now, let’s delve into some more of the bad stuff, but keep in mind that she always gets back up! The subsequent years saw Demi Lovato continuing to dominate the charts, releasing hit after hit. The musical journey was full of success. Albums like Here We Go Again, Unbroken, Demi, Confident, and Tell Me You Love Me featured a plethora of popular songs that resonated with her ever-growing fanbase. She was known for her vocal range. I mean, we're talking about a powerhouse vocalist who could hit notes that many artists can only dream of. These songs became anthems for many people. She was incredibly consistent with releasing hit songs, and kept building up her discography. Her music was a source of support and connection for many of her fans. But here's where things get real. While the good kept coming, her personal struggles were becoming more apparent. I mean, nobody's perfect, right?
Behind the bright lights and the catchy tunes, Demi was battling some major demons. She publicly struggled with eating disorders, self-harm, and substance abuse. It’s hard to imagine, but during the height of her success, she was dealing with a lot of personal turmoil. These issues began to affect her career, causing her to take breaks and seek professional help. The honesty in her music offered insight into these private battles, and allowed her to connect with fans on a deeper level. The Unbroken album was a testament to her strength, as she bared her soul through her music. While her success continued, her personal life faced many trials.
